Difference between multistage centrifugal pump and single stage pump

15 Jun 2019Email

Compared with the single-stage pump, the difference is that the multi-stage pump has more than two impellers, which can absorb water and press water in multiple stages in stages, so that the water can be raised to a high position, and the lift can be increased or decreased as needed. Multi-stage pumps are mainly used for mine drainage, urban and factory water supply, and few for agricultural irrigation. They are only suitable for high-lift, low-flow high mountain water to solve the difficulty of drinking water for humans and animals.

 

multistage pump structure

 

The multi-stage pump has two types: vertical and horizontal.

The main models are D-type and DL multi-stage centrifugal pumps, and DW and DWL small multi-stage centrifugal pumps.

 

D type multistage pump DL type vertical multistage pump

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

(1) D-type multi-stage pump performance range flow rate 6.3 ~ 720 cubic meters / hour, lift 16 ~ 600 meters, inlet diameter: 50, 75, 100, 125, 150, 200 mm, of which 50 ~ 125 mm pump type The high speed is 2950 rpm, and the 150-200 mm pump type speed is 1480 rpm.

 

(2) The structural type D multistage centrifugal pump is horizontal multi-stage (2~12 grade), the impeller is single suction, and the pump body is segmented. When the first stage impeller is double suction, it is indicated by DS. When two speeds are specified at the same time, the low speed is indicated by DA, and the multistage centrifugal pump used for boiler feed water is indicated by DG.

1. Single-stage pump refers to a pump with only one impeller. The maximum lift is only 125 meters.

 

single stage pump

 

2. Multi-stage pump refers to a pump with two or more impellers. It can absorb water and pressure in multiple stages. Therefore, the water can be raised to a high position, and the lift can increase or decrease the number of stages of the pump impeller according to the need; the multi-stage pump can be matched by increasing the number of impellers in the case where the single-stage pump head needs to be equipped with two-stage motors. The use of four-stage motor can improve the service life of the pump and reduce the noise of the unit.

 

multistage pump

 

3. When the pump actually needs less than 125 meters, it can be based on the pump room area and pump price (multi-stage pumps are generally higher than single-stage pumps). The factors such as single-stage pump or multi-stage pump are considered comprehensively.
